Utilizing Free Tools for Product Research

Fortunately, a plethora of free tools exist to streamline your dropshipping product research. Here are some recommended options:

  1. Google Trends:
    Analyze Google trends and statistics to track the popularity of various search terms over time. Gain valuable insights into currently sought-after products.
  2. AliExpress:
    As a leading dropshipping platform, AliExpress proves invaluable for product research. Its extensive product catalog and user reviews offer insights into the potential profitability of different items.
  3. Social Media:
    Harness social media platforms such as Instagram, Facebook, and Pinterest to discover trending products. Monitor popular influencer accounts and relevant hashtags within your niche to stay informed about high-performing products.
  4. Online Marketplaces:
    Websites like Amazon, eBay, and Etsy serve as excellent sources of inspiration for product ideas. Identify best-selling products in your chosen niche and analyze customer reviews to gauge their potential success in your dropshipping store.

Step 3: Securing Trustworthy Suppliers

In the realm of no-money dropshipping, the selection of reliable suppliers is a critical juncture. To assist you in this crucial step, consider the following criteria when identifying suppliers:

  1. Product Quality:
    Positive reviews and ratings serve as indicators of product quality.
  2. Reliability and Efficiency:
    Partner with trustworthy suppliers known for promptly fulfilling orders.
  3. Shipping Options and Costs:
    Evaluate the shipping options and associated costs provided by suppliers. Timely delivery and reasonable shipping fees are crucial customer expectations.
  4. Inventory Management:
    Opt for suppliers with a reliable inventory management system. Accurate stock updates and the prevention of backorders are vital aspects of successful collaboration.

Partnering with Influencers:

Incorporating influencer marketing is a cost-effective approach to broaden your reach and enhance sales. Follow these steps:

  1. Identify Relevant Influencers:
    Seek influencers aligned with your niche who have a substantial following. Examine their engagement rates and confirm their audience aligns with your target customers.
  2. Reach Out with a Proposal:
    Compose a personalized message outlining your business, the benefits influencers will receive by endorsing your products, and any compensation you can provide. Be authentic and demonstrate your research efforts.
  3. Offer Unique Discount Codes:
    Provide influencers with exclusive discount codes to share with their followers. This not only incentivizes their audience to make a purchase but also enables you to track the influencer’s performance.

Scaling Your Dropshipping Business: Strategies for Growth

If you’re an aspiring dropshipper, you’re likely exploring ways to elevate your business and maximize profits. The key to scaling your dropshipping venture involves two core strategies: diversifying your product range and cultivating partnerships with multiple suppliers.

1. Expanding Product Offerings:

To scale your dropshipping business effectively, consider broadening your product selection. Offering a more extensive range allows you to cater to a larger audience, thereby increasing your sales potential. Thorough market research is essential to identify high-demand products that align with your target customer’s preferences and needs.

When expanding your product catalog, think about introducing complementary items that enhance your existing products. This not only encourages upselling but also enhances the overall shopping experience for your customers.

2. Collaborating with Multiple Suppliers:

Another scaling strategy for your dropshipping business is establishing partnerships with multiple suppliers. Diversifying your supplier network mitigates the risk of relying solely on one source for your inventory, ensuring a continuous supply of products. Even if one supplier encounters issues with stock availability or shipping delays, you can maintain business operations.

Working with multiple suppliers also enables you to compare pricing, quality, and shipping times. This empowers you to offer competitive prices while maintaining a reliable and efficient order fulfillment process.

It’s vital to cultivate strong relationships with your suppliers and maintain effective communication to ensure smooth operations. Regularly assess your suppliers’ performance and make necessary adjustments to optimize your dropshipping business.

How do you calculate dropshipping profit?

Calculate profit by subtracting product cost, shipping cost, and fees from the selling price. Consistent tracking helps optimize your dropshipping business.

What are the risks of dropshipping?

Risks include product quality issues, shipping delays, and reliance on suppliers. Mitigate risks through thorough research and supplier vetting.

Can I dropship from multiple suppliers?

Yes, dropshipping from multiple suppliers is a common strategy to diversify inventory sources and reduce risks.

Do I need to handle product returns in dropshipping?

While some responsibilities may fall on the supplier, handling returns is often the responsibility of the dropshipper. Clear return policies are essential.

How do I find trending products for dropshipping?

Utilize tools like Google Trends, social media, and online marketplaces to identify trending products. Regularly research and adapt to market changes.

Can I dropship branded products?

Dropshipping branded products may have legal implications. Verify with suppliers and respect intellectual property laws to avoid legal issues.

Can I dropship internationally?

Yes, dropshipping internationally is possible, but consider factors like shipping times, customs regulations, and customer service challenges.
